Print, Cerasus Avium
This is a Print. It was print maker: Lemaire and after Pierre Joseph Redouté. It is dated ca. 1820 and we acquired it in 1961. Its medium is engraving, brush and watercolor on paper. It is a part of the Drawings, Prints, and Graphic Design department.
This object was
donated by
Hamill & Barker.
It is credited Gift of Hamill and Barker.
Its dimensions are
30.6 × 22.4 cm (12 1/16 × 8 13/16 in.)
